Sideburn key fobs

A perfect Christmas present.

Hand-cut, stitched, debossed Sideburn logo on one side and Goodyear/Dunlop tread effect on the other. These are a great quality veg tanned leather which will age real nice and gnarly with use.
The leather measures approx 3" in length, 1" wide and 1/4" thick depending on which part of the hide its cut from. Solid brass, nickel-plated D ring. Comes supplied with a split ring to attach your keys.

Made in England.

Old leather

A load of boxes stored in my parents’ loft recently turned up a nostalgia-overdose. In among the Subbuteo and Scalextric, the graffiti-plastered school books and old rugby boots was this, my first ever leather jacket. I got it when I was about 14 years old. The Triumph obsession was served by a tatty Tiger Cub that, just as I was old enough to ride it on the road with L-plates (17), the law changed and pushed it out of reach. The Isle of Man patch was from my first ever TT, with my mate Smiffy (and his parents) when we were 15. That white ‘LP’? Teen love in Humbrol enamel. The lining’s long gone and it smells like a dying Labrador, but it’s a keeper. Can anyone ever chuck out their old leathers? It’s a skin thing. MP
